Well, well, well. Who knew that Kanye was the biggest rock star on the planet? Watching Glastonbury back, as I didn't see much live being the working "rock star" that I am, I was stunned by Kanye's arrogance, ego and overall nerve to be so unhumble (new word for Summer). He really is something else. If his performance would have merited such a statement then maybe I could have let him off, but he sounded like a goat trying to get off some barbed wire. Dreadful is a super understatement. Miming at one point to undoubtedly one of — if not the actual — greatest rock star ever in Freddie Mercury, Kanye totally forgot the words and just looked really awkward. For a headline act at one of the world's biggest festivals he failed to bring anything other than flat notes and big headedness to what should have been the best performance of the weekend. He pretty much insulted every other performer on the bill and others who have graced the stage before him. He was an absolute disgrace to the music industry and really did show himself up to be quite an idiot. Americans can usually talk the talk while walking the walk, but this fool can't really do either without looking totally stupid.
